A major chapter in the PDF focuses on Ru'yat Allah . Al-Athari affirms that believers will see Allah in Paradise with their physical eyes, but not in a spatial direction. He refutes those who say "Allah cannot be seen" (the Mu'tazila) and those who say "Allah is a body that you can look at" (the Mujassima).

Al-Athari provides a sobering look at eschatology, detailing the minor and major signs of the Hour, the trials of the grave, the Resurrection, the Accountability (Hisab), the Scales (Meezan), the Bridge (Sirat), and the ultimate destinations of Paradise (Jannah) and Hellfire (Jahannam). 6.
